It was not quite the holiday gift downtown merchants doing business off Main Street wanted. Monday night City Commissioners endorsed a concept that provides up to three 18-by-12-inch sign boards each on 18 fluted poles that will be placed at strategically located corners along Main Street. The merchants, however, wanted to be able to place sandwich-style signboards on Main Street to lure customers off the main drag. ...more
